What are the elements of graphic design?

Graphic design elements: Graphic design can use image-based designs that include images, illustrations, logos, and symbols, type-based designs, or a combination of both techniques. 
Shapes: Shapes provide a variety of ways to creatively fill in spaces, to support text and other content shapes, and to balance a design. Shapes can be created from nothing, using white space to give the design structure and clarity.
Color: Color, or the absence of color, is an important component of any design. With a solid understanding of color theory, designers can amazingly influence design and branding, incorporating color seamlessly with boldness or with exquisite subtlety.
Type: Writing can transform a message from just text into a work of art. Different fonts, along with custom alignment, spacing, size, and color, can add strength to the point at which you connect with the world.
Texture: Even a smooth and glossy ad can feel tactile with texture. It gives a sense of tactile surface through its visual appearance and adds a sense of depth, enhanced by choosing the right paper and materials.

What is the definition of graphic design?

A standard dictionary definition of graphic design would say that it is an artistic profession or process that relies on visual communication for the purpose of conveying information to a specific or general audience.

Explain the process of starting a project in graphic design?

Starting the Project: One of the most important steps in the design process is gathering the information you will need. This is usually accomplished either through a face to face meeting with the client, a survey, or even a Skype meeting if you really want to establish a personal relationship. When you collect this information, you now know your customer's goals and can focus on the details to include in your brief.
Ensures that the client knows what they want from the project
The more information the client provides at the outset, the better the outcome for both of you (especially the client). Topics to be included in the design brief may vary but some good starting points may be:
Company profile - Business summary
Communication mission - what message are you trying to convey and by what means (eg, logos, body copying, photography, etc.)
Target market - demographics - age, gender, income, employment, geography, lifestyle of those the customer wants to reach.
Goals - What is the measurable result that the client wants to achieve?
Timeline/Deadline - A realistic timeline for how the project will proceed.
At this point it is also a good idea to accept a deposit for the first half of the project.
